Re: Some things
A sign of the times I'm afraid. How many people remember Wasteland? Or even Master of Orion or the original Civilization? Graphics weren't great, couldn't get "great" at the time but the games were still top notch. Anybody still play them now that better looking games are out? My guess would be yes. The graphics don't need to be great if the gameplay can hook you. On the other hand nothin p*sses me off more than buying a game that has a cool premise and sweet graphiccs but is worthless to play... can anyone say Outpost?

Re: Some things
Don't forget Empire Deluxe.
3X game from about 8 years ago.
256 colors
Simple 2D graphics
Superb easy to use senariou editor
Fair AI, (for the time)
Still a nice beer and pretzles game for a night when I can't sleep and too tired for SEIV.
In my opinio: Graphics for games are highly over rated.
My priorityes in no real order are:
Ease of play, (I would like to see this improved in SE but it is not a show stopper)
Acceptable AI, (keep in mind that the human mind makes more caculations per second than any super computer)
Depth, (not cheap)
Multi person play
We all have different wants and needs. Those are mine.
